Adams Farm Vermont Sleigh Rides Release date August 2003 Adams Farm's horse drawn sleigh rides take visitors on a magical journey up the mountain and through the snowy sugar grove to the log cabin in the woods. At the cabin, visitors enjoy a warm up by the fire, a cup of hot chocolate, and tunes on the antique player piano. The drivers narrate the whole trip with interesting and humorous stories about farm life, the draft horses, the maple sugar grove, and Vermont life in general.
During the fall, the horses get back into shape for sleigh ride season by pulling slab wood from the farm's sawmill to the sugarhouse where it will be used for the next year's sugaring season. Adams Farm is a working sixth-generation farm in southern Vermont, offering the public seasonal activities and agricultural interactive experiences for the whole family, as well as a complete Farm Store and Quilt & Fiber Arts Loft.
